8th grade science is inquiry-based. Students create explanations and draw conclusions based on their observations and discoveries. In addition, we use a digital platform called Amplify Science to cover various Next Generation Science Standards (NGSS). Topics include energy, chemistry, and physics. Throughout the year, we will discuss current events as well.
This year, the Cole science curriculum aligns with the physical science topics in Amplify Science.
Harnessing Human Energy
Forces and Motion
Magnetic Fields
Thermal Energy
Phase Change
Chemical Reactions
Light Waves
